Blearn Mobile is a gateway app for moodLearning-supported corporate and academic eLearning platforms, including the University of the Philippines' MyPortal.Special support is given to the Blearn platform for training and professional development. Blearn (blearn.co) enables teachers and trainors to deploy online instruction, leveraging diverse learning styles of trainees. It gives flexibility of instruction, allowing students access to training materials and activities when and how they want them, and giving instructors the advantage of extending participant engagement beyond the initial training conditions.
Content and training providers may contact moodLearning's Support Team (contact@moodlearning.com) for access to the platforms.
Most recent feature: mL eCoach. Coaches or mentors can have access to progress reports (grades, submissions, feedback, etc.) on their mentees, who can be tracked across courses on the LMS.
